Login To The Netgear VMDG480v2 Router Using Your Web Browser

Open a web browser like Internet Explorer or Firefox. Enter the internal IP address of your router in the address bar of your browser.

Netgear VMDG480v2 Screenshot 0

In the picture above the address bar has http://www.google.com in it. Just replace all of that with the internal IP address of your Netgear VMDG480v2 router. By default the IP address should be set to 192.168.0.1.

Netgear VMDG480v2 Screenshot 1

You should see a box prompting you for your username and password. Enter your username and password now.

The Default Netgear VMDG480v2 Router Username is: admin

The Default Netgear VMDG480v2 Router Password is: changeme


Click the Sign In button to log in to your Netgear VMDG480v2 router.

Forward Ports 20-22 on the Netgear VMDG480v2

We will list a series of lines here that will show you exactly how to forward the ports you need to forward. QNAP TS-439 Pro Turbo NAS requires you to forward the 20-22,25,80,137-139,443,445,548,873,3306,6000,6881-6999,8080,9000,13131,55536-56559 ports.
